Transaction af103aa7e6542b43e4e24f7d3bb4e643044ecc3248fcb7bb2947ecc504a04f51
4 Input
2 Outputs
- af103aa7e6542b43e4e24f7d3bb4e643044ecc3248fcb7bb2947ecc504a04f51:0
- af103aa7e6542b43e4e24f7d3bb4e643044ecc3248fcb7bb2947ecc504a04f51:1
value 630000000
address 1PgQn9rUhcHv39aPY5qbynUvM8bZh6ikm1
value 333939262
address 1DFBV2aDAL8XayS1N9vGGjBTaCmA8FkGmJ